CAPES to Provide Scopus Access to Brazilian Researchers

Scopus®, the largest abstract and citation database of peer-reviewed literature and quality web sources with smart tools to track, analyze and visualize research, and the Brazilian Federal Agency for the Support and Evaluation of Graduate Education (CAPES) announced an agreement to make Scopus available to 44 of Brazil’s leading universities and research institutes. Scopus was selected for its comprehensive and multidisciplinary coverage.

“In signing with Scopus, CAPES fulfils its commitment to make available to Brazil’s scientific and technological communities a powerful tool that provides access to state-of-the-art knowledge from all over the world. Scopus is the largest multidisciplinary database on scientific publications and it substantially increases the number of journals that may be reached and viewed by our scientists,” said CAPES President Professor Jorge Guimarães in a statement at the signing ceremony held at the Brazilian Ministry of Education.

Another factor driving CAPES’ interest in Scopus was the database’s research performance measurement capabilities and its potential to further the scientific development of Brazil. Professor Guimarães added: “Scopus offers the possibility to quickly and precisely access innumerable data on the development and advancement of our science and the highlights of our schooling and makes it possible to compare with other countries. Finally, in making available to our researchers, graduate students and their mentors one more service with free access we are supporting the academic community and therefore contributing to the development of our country.”

Jaco Zijlstra, Scopus Director said: “We are proud to have been selected to join CAPES’ already impressive body of scientific resources and to provide CAPES and their research community with the tools they need to further the advancement of science in Brazil.”
